paper v0.10: post-review revision — the freeze is over, the queue ships

The review process concluded 2026-08 (operator released the hold). Folds
in exactly the staged erratum-queue + v0.10 items, nothing else:
- corpus count sentence made historical (sixteen at the studied leaves;
  forty-four per fork since — the log records both generations)
- the 3,867/73,573 divergence finding gains its closure everywhere it
  appears: root cause = deployed verifier omitted RFC 9162 S2.1.4.2
  Step 7's terminal sn=0 condition (fixed in ddbb5a4); zero divergences
  post-fix, three-way regression
- new limitations paragraph 'Replay-harness integrity' (a wrong
  observation needs no malice)
- adversary model: defective-harness clause
- claim matrix: 'recorded cone was produced by an audit that performed
  its checks — not established' row
- title page carries 'Revised: August 2026'; submitted v0.9 (7f140356)
  preserved in git history; paper/README signpost updated

\paragraph{Replay-harness integrity.}
A wrong observation needs no malice: a defective replay harness --- a bug in
the audit driver, a fail-open guard, a truncated transcript --- produces the
same evidentiary damage as a dishonest operator, with the same accountability
answer (the record is attributable and persistent; independent replay corrects
it). The subject corpus's adversarial gate self-tests exist for exactly this
reason and reduce, but cannot eliminate, the exposure.
